Pune: The Economic Offence Wing (EOW) of Pune police on Friday conducted searches at the residences of Shital Tejwani, who has been arrested in connection with the Mundhwa land deal case that also involves a firm in which Deputy Chief Minister Ajit Pawar's son Parth is a partner, an official said.

The searches were carried out at Tejwani's residences in Pune and Pimpri Chinchwad civic limits, he added.

Tejwani, the power of attorney holder for a 40-acre government land in Mundhwa that she "sold" to Amadea Enterprises LLP, a firm in which Parth Pawar is a partner, for Rs 300 crore, was arrested on Wednesday by EOW.
